Insulated siding installation involves attaching specialized siding materials that incorporate insulation directly into the panels or as a backing layer. This process enhances the exterior of a property by providing an additional barrier against temperature fluctuations, improving energy efficiency, and reducing heating and cooling costs. The installation typically requires careful preparation of the existing exterior surface, precise measurement, and secure attachment of the insulated panels to ensure durability and effectiveness. Skilled contractors focus on seamless integration to maintain the aesthetic appeal of the property while maximizing the insulating benefits.
One of the primary issues insulated siding helps address is energy loss through the walls. Older or poorly insulated exteriors often allow drafts and heat transfer, leading to higher utility bills and inconsistent indoor temperatures. Insulated siding acts as a thermal barrier, reducing heat exchange and helping to maintain a more stable indoor environment. Additionally, it can prevent moisture infiltration and protect against external elements, which can contribute to issues like mold growth or wood rot. Proper installation ensures that these problems are mitigated, enhancing the overall comfort and longevity of the property.

Material Costs - The cost of insulated siding materials can range from approximately $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type and quality chosen. For a typical 2,000-square-foot home, material expenses might fall between $4,000 and $16,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ific product selections.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ally range from $1 to $4 per square foot, influenced by the home's size and complexity. For a standard home, labor charges could be between $2,000 and $8,000. Prices vary across different service providers and project specifics.
Total Project Costs - Combining materials and labor, total costs for insulated siding installation usually fall between $6,000 and $24,000 for an average-sized home. Larger or more intricate projects may exceed this range, depending on scope and location.
Additional Fees - Extra expenses such as surface preparation, removal of existing siding, or repairs can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the overall cost. Local contractors can clarify potential additional charges during the consultation process.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of insulated siding installation? Insulated siding can impro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, and provide additional insulation for the home.
How long does insulated siding installation typically take? The duration varies depending on the home's size and complexity,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ific projects.
Is insulated siding compatible with existing siding? In many cases, insulated siding can be installed over existing siding,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ine suitability.
What types of materials are used for insulated siding? Common materials include vinyl, fiber cement, and composite panels, each offering different aesthetic and performance qualities.
